180 degree magazine (a monthly magazine of style, art, fashion and design) was founded by a group of committed photographers in 2004. Now with the release of the December issue the group has opened "
180 Gallery": an online sales gallery for contributors to 180 magazine, where prints are delivered from 180 Gallery or directly from the artist.
